Zelensky congratulates Prabowo, invites him to global peace summit

Source
Tempo - March 23, 2024

Andika Dwi (Kyiv Independent), Jakarta –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ky had a phone call with Indonesian President-elect Prabowo Subianto on March 18, after the former general claimed victory in the February 14 election.

As reported by Kyiv Independent, Zelensky congratulated Prabowo on his success in the election and expressed hope for continued mutually beneficial bilateral relations.

Zelensky also invited Prabowo to attend the Global Peace Summit slated to be held in Switzerland in the coming months.

"It was in Indonesia in 2022 that I presented the Peace Formula," Zelensky said, mentioning the 10-point peace plan at the G20 summit in Bali, Indonesia, in November 2022.

He said that Indonesia has a potential role in implementing the points of the peace formula regarding food security and nuclear security, as well as prisoner exchanges.

"We are now preparing for the inaugural peace summit, and Indonesia's participation in it is of fundamental importance to us. I have invited them to take part in the summit and implement the points on food and nuclear security, as well as the exchange of prisoners of war," the Ukrainian President concluded.

Russia-Ukraine peace proposal

Serving as Indonesian Defense Minister, Prabowo had once proposed a peaceful solution to the conflict between Russia and Ukraine. The solution is known as the Russia-Ukraine Peace Proposal, which was presented at the Shangri-La Dialogue in Singapore in June 2023.

In response, Ukrainian Minister of Defense Oleksii Reznikov said on June 2, 2023, that his side dismissed the proposal, calling it a strange proposal.

"It sounds like a Russian plan, not an Indonesian plan," he said, as reported by Ukrinform.net. "We don't need this mediator coming to us with this strange plan."
